What to check before for buildings with low rent increases near the BX7 bus in Inwood

  • Use bx7-bus to keep your commute area tight, then compare the specific unit’s rent history and the language of any renewal/increase notice.
  • Treat “low-rent-increases” as a building-level pattern, not a guarantee for every unit or every future lease term—ask about how increases are calculated in writing.
  • Before you sign, confirm the full monthly move-in cost: deposits, any broker fee requirements, and utility responsibilities (they can change the real affordability).
  • Check building rules that affect day-to-day life (laundry access, package handling, and any restrictions) since they vary even within the same commute corridor.
  • If multiple units are advertised, compare lease start dates and allowable move-in timing; the best match on rent increases can still be a mismatch on timing.
